A tripod was used for all shots with the exception of one as it was easier and helped the camera stay in focus better as they was no shaking hand which can make the video look unprofessional.
The tripod was a great piece of equipment to use as it had extendable legs therefore we could vary the height of the camera. This was useful for the Over the Shoulder shots as me and Liam are different heights.
For the shots that acted like the CCTV we used to tripod to our advantage by extending the legs to the longest possible and then standing it on a high table that was in the cafetiere. We were also able to tilt the camera so that it really did look like it was a CCTV camera in action. I thought that this came across very effective and realistic.
